What Is Minimally Invasive Aesthetic Treatment?
Minimally invasive aesthetic treatment uses small techniques to improve appearance. It reduces recovery time and risk compared to surgery. Common methods include injectables, lasers, and microneedling. These treatments target specific facial regions for natural-looking rejuvenation.
How Does Regional Approach Improve Aesthetic Results?
A regional approach focuses on treating specific facial areas. It ensures balanced and harmonious results by addressing multiple zones. This method customizes treatment plans based on individual anatomy. It leads to more precise and effective rejuvenation outcomes.
What Role Does Ai Play In Plastic Surgery?
AI helps plastic surgeons with diagnosis, treatment planning, and outcome prediction. It enhances precision by analyzing patient data and images. AI improves safety by identifying risks early. It supports personalized and efficient aesthetic treatment strategies.
Are Minimally Invasive Treatments Suitable For All Skin Types?
Yes, minimally invasive treatments can be adapted for most skin types. Specialists evaluate skin condition before choosing the best method. Personalized plans ensure safe and effective results. This approach minimizes complications and optimizes skin rejuvenation.
How Long Is Recovery After Minimally Invasive Treatments?
Recovery time is usually short, often a few days to a week. Most patients resume normal activities quickly. Minimal swelling or bruising may occur but fades fast. This quick recovery is a key benefit of minimally invasive procedures.
